Latest ensemble forecasts from global models place Shanghai's September 8 high near 29–30°C under partly cloudy skies and moderate northerly flow, with limited daytime heating from increased cloud cover and humidity near 60 percent. Current conditions on September 6 show highs around 30°C amid similar patterns, supporting the tight market split where 30°C leads slightly at 44 percent implied probability and 29°C follows at 43 percent. Minor model disagreements on exact cloud timing and boundary-layer mixing create the narrow gap, while lower probabilities for 28°C or 31°C reflect outlier runs. Updated short-range guidance and observational data over the next 48 hours will likely refine these odds ahead of resolution.

The resolution source for this market will be information from NOAA, specifically the highest reading under the "Temp" column for all times on this day, available here: https://www.weather.gov/wrh/timeseries?site=zspd
If NOAA data for the observation date is unavailable by 11:59 PM ET on the day following the observation date, the Weather Underground Daily Observations table will be used as the resolution source.
In the event that there is no data for the observation date by 11:59 PM ET on the day following the observation date, this market will resolve to the lowest bracket.
To toggle between Fahrenheit and Celsius, click the "Switch to Metric Units" button until the relevant table displays °C.
This market will resolve once the first data point for the following date has been published on the resolution source, or by 11:59 PM ET on the day following the observation date, whichever comes first.
The resolution source for this market measures temperatures to whole degrees Celsius (eg, 9°C). Thus, this is the level of precision that will be used when resolving the market.
Revisions to temperatures recorded within this market's timeframe will be considered until the first datapoint for the following date has been published, after which any alterations will not be considered.
